WebMethane is a colorless and odorless gas or a liquid under pressure. It is used as a light source and fuel, and is the major gas present in Natural Gas. It is also used in making many other chemicals, such as Acetylene and Methanol. ... Today, about 60 percentof the methane in the atmosphere comes from sources scientists think of as human caused, while the rest comes from sources that existed before humans started influencing the carbon cycle in dramatic ways.
